What is the solution to the system of equations?

{x=5y=2x−1



(5,9)

(9,5)

(5,11)

(11,5)

Answer:

(5,9)

Step-by-step explanation:

x= 5

y= 2x-1

y= 2(5)-1

y=9

x=5----> (5,9)
